BANDA ACEH - The public prosecutor of the Pidie Jaya District Attorney's Office (Kejari), Aceh Province, executed the caning of two convicts of extortion or gambling whose cases have permanent legal force or inkrah.

The caning was carried out in public in public at the Agung Tgk Chik Pante Geulima Mosque, Meureudu, the capital of Pidie Jaya Regency, Thursday, September 25.

The two convicts, namely Sabrul Kamal and Fahkrul Badminton (19), both residents of Gampong Meunasah Balek, Meureudu District, Pidie Jaya Regency, are students.

Both were found guilty by the panel of judges at the Meureudu Sharia Court violated Article 18 of Aceh Qanun Number 6 of 2014 concerning the law of jinayah with a sentence of 10 lashes. Article 18 regulates the title of judging.

Head of the General Crime Section of the Pidie Jaya Kejari, Suheri Wira Firnanda, said that the implementation of the caning law after the case had permanent legal force based on the decision of the Meureudu Sharia Court.

"The two convicts were sentenced to 10 lashes cut to a detention period. Both of them served a caning sentence just six times after being cut to a detention period of 118 days or four months," Suheri said as quoted by ANTARA, Friday, September 26.

Suheri Wira Firnanda said the reduced sentence was in accordance with the provisions of Article 23 Paragraph (3) of Aceh Qanun Number 7 of 2013 concerning the law of the jinayat event, where every 30 days the detention period is calculated equivalent to one lashes.

According to Suheri, the implementation of the whips in addition to carrying out court orders is also part of the commitment to enforce Islamic law in Pidie Jaya Regency.

"We hope that this punishment will serve as a lesson for the convict and also a deterrent effect for the community so that they no longer perform major or gambling policies or other violations of Islamic law," said Suheri Wira Firnanda.
